Preparation for higher education
There are two high school graduation plans that prepare students for college.
Recommended High School Program (RHSP) A 24-credit, college-preparatory curriculum that
helps ensure that all Texas high school students take advanced mathematics and science courses
The Distinguished Achievement Program (DAP) The state’s advanced high school graduation plan

How will I pay for college?Financial aid can assist persons from any background pay for college. It doesn’t matter if you are:
Poor or rich Male or female The first in your family to
attend college
There is a type of financial aid for everyone.
Types of financial aid: Scholarships Grants Work study /
employment
opportunities Loans
